Former RHHS QBs lead teams to victory

Two former Wildcats led their Bulldogs to wins Saturday — one early and one late.

Dominique Allen, playing in his first game of the season, led The Citadel to a 19-14 win over Furman, scoring on a 1-yard touchdown run with less than five minutes to play. Down 14-13, Allen also threw two 20-yard passes on the 10-play, 78-yard winning drive.

The Citadel Bulldogs are now 2-0 overall and in the Southern Conference and play at Gardner-Webb at 6 p.m. Saturday.

Nick Fitzgerald, Allen’s successor at Richmond Hill, set a new school record for quarterbacks by running for 195 yards in a 27-14 Mississippi State win over South Carolina, outscoring the Gamecocks 21-0 in the first half. Fitzgerald threw for 178 yards and two touchdowns as his Bulldogs moved to 1-1 overall and 1-0 in the SEC.

Mississippi State plays at LSU at 7 p.m. Saturday on ESPN2.
